Best time to visit Middelburg depends on your activities. The Highveld climate enjoys warm summers and cooler winters, with most visitors favouring the drier winter months for outdoor exploration and clearer skies. If you are keen on outdoor walks, scenery, and photography, plan for mornings or late afternoons when light is softer and temperatures are more comfortable. Bear in mind that peak holiday periods can raise occupancy levels and room rates, so booking ahead is wise if your travel window is fixed.
